May 29, 2026Understanding the Basics of Blackjack
Blackjack is one of the most popular casino games in the USA, combining skill, strategy, and luck. To play, players aim to beat the dealer by reaching a hand total of 21 or as close as possible without exceeding it. Familiarizing yourself with Blackjack rules is essential before diving into the game. Basic moves like hitting, standing, splitting, and doubling down form the foundation of every hand. Practicing these fundamentals helps players build confidence and apply Blackjack tips effectively in real-time scenarios.
The History and Evolution of Blackjack
Blackjack traces its roots to 18th-century France, where it was known as “Vingt-et-Un.” The game gained popularity in the USA during the 1950s and 1960s, thanks to mathematicians who developed early Blackjack strategies. Over time, variations like Spanish 21 and Double Exposure emerged, adding diversity to the game. Today, online Blackjack platforms allow players to enjoy the game from anywhere, making it more accessible than ever.
Key Blackjack Rules Every Player Should Know
Mastering Blackjack rules is crucial for success. The dealer acts as the house, and players compete against them individually. Aces count as 1 or 11, face cards are worth 10, and numbered cards retain their face value. The game ends when all players have completed their hands. Knowing when to hit, stand, or split pairs can significantly impact your outcomes. For example, splitting aces or eights is generally advisable, while splitting fives is not. These nuances highlight the importance of understanding the core mechanics of the game.
Advanced Blackjack Strategies for Winning
Developing a solid strategy is key to improving your chances at the table. Basic strategy charts outline optimal decisions for every possible hand combination, reducing the house edge to as low as 0.5%. Advanced players also use techniques like card counting, though this requires intense focus and practice. Combining Blackjack strategies with disciplined bankroll management ensures long-term success. For instance, setting win/loss limits and avoiding emotional decisions can prevent costly mistakes.
Card Counting Techniques in Blackjack
Card counting is a controversial yet effective method for gaining an edge in Blackjack. The Hi-Lo system is one of the most common approaches, assigning values to cards and tracking the running count. A higher count indicates a greater proportion of high cards remaining in the deck, which favors the player. While not illegal, card counting is frowned upon by casinos, and players may be asked to leave if detected. Online Blackjack eliminates this risk, allowing players to practice card counting in a risk-free environment.

Blackjack Etiquette and Table Manners
Proper etiquette enhances the experience for all players and dealers. Avoid touching your chips after placing a bet, and never handle the cards directly. Refrain from giving unsolicited advice to fellow players, as this can disrupt the flow of the game. In live casinos, wait for the dealer to complete a hand before making your move. Online, respect chat features and avoid aggressive language. These small courtesies contribute to a positive and professional atmosphere.
Popular Blackjack Variations in the USA
The USA has embraced several Blackjack variations, each with unique rules. Classic Blackjack remains the most widely played, while games like Atlantic City Blackjack and Vegas Strip Blackjack offer slight rule modifications. Side bets like “Insurance” and “21+3” add excitement but increase the house edge. Exploring these variations can diversify your skills and keep the game engaging. Online Blackjack platforms often feature multiple versions, allowing players to experiment with different rulesets.
Common Mistakes to Avoid in Blackjack
Even experienced players can fall into common traps. One mistake is deviating from basic strategy due to superstition or peer pressure. Another is overbetting after a win, which can lead to rapid losses. Failing to track your bankroll is another pitfall that can derail progress. To avoid these issues, stick to proven Blackjack strategies and treat each hand as an independent event. Regularly reviewing your gameplay and adjusting tactics can help you stay ahead of the curve.
